Regional Methods and Global Capability Centers

The option of place for a GCC in 2026 is influenced by more than just labor costs. Access to specialized abilities, city government stability, and the existence of a mature tech network are the main drivers. Eastern Europe has ended up being a favorite for business requiring high-end engineering skill with proximity to Western European head office. On The Other Hand, Southeast Asia supplies a gateway to a few of the fastest-growing markets worldwide. India continues to lead in sheer volume and the maturity of its GCC network, having hosted over 175 centers developed through specialized advisory services.

These centers are now tasked with more than just software advancement. They deal with AI impact on GCC productivity, cybersecurity, and the training of custom-made large language designs.
